WebMaking a Report of Suspected Child Abuse/Neglect. Mandated reporters shall make an immediate report to CI by telephone or through the online reporting system, of suspected child abuse or child neglect. Within 72 hours after making an oral report by telephone, the reporting person shall file a written report (DHS-3200). WebJustice was to develop a protocol for handling child abuse and neglect cases in Michigan. The Model Child Abuse and Neglect Protocol was created in 1993, revised in 1998 and again in 2013. The Model Child Abuse and Neglect Protocol is to be used by each county to create a community child abuse and neglect protocol as noted in the Statement of ... WebOct 25, 2024 · In Michigan, there are two methods of terminating parental rights — the Adoption Code and the Juvenile Code. To make a child available for adoption, the birth parents’ parental rights will first be terminated. Sometimes this is done by consent, and other times, it must be contested.
